Output 58b964115ca6063cd21108a779ca8c0436f2a07832afe23ef0a35c2d90349a7b:0

value
59870800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85326acdd1d80a0c78b505c24785b761bcc98caa OP_EQUAL
address
3DqJC76SGH2EQLajfb6wRLJoEKQzoJjuAQ
transaction
58b964115ca6063cd21108a779ca8c0436f2a07832afe23ef0a35c2d90349a7b
spent
true